There's a growing demand for professionals who understand and can manage operations in the procurement, warehousing, and transporting of goods in an increasingly global market. Coursework includes leading-edge supply chain strategies and technologies like Radio-Frequency Identification (RFID), Six Sigma quality methodology, e-logistics and green logistics, and much more.
